Despite the intervening decades, the woman, known only as The Mother, is met with the same questions: Where are you from? No, where are you really from? The American-born daughter of Bengali immigrant parents, her truthful answer, here, is never enough. She finds herself navigating a climate of lingering racism with three daughters in tow and a husband who spends more time in business class than at home.<\/p>\n<p>The Mother&#8217;s simmering anger breaks through one morning, when, during a baseless and prejudice-driven police raid on her house, she finally refuses to be calm, complacent, polite\u2014and is ultimately shot. As she lies bleeding on her driveway, The Mother struggles to make sense of her past and decipher her present\u2014how did she end up here?<\/p>\n<p>Devi S. Laskar has written a brilliant debut novel novel that grapples with the complexities of the second-generation American experience, what it means to be a woman of color in the workplace, a sister, a wife, a mother to daughters in today&#8217;s America. I get what the underlying message the author was trying to communicate. The second-rate judgement. The implying racism. I get it. It\u2019s important to write on these matters. But writing about them &amp; having a voice are two different things. The thing that most bothered me was the writing style. What Goodreads mentions as \u2018lyrical prose\u2019 is nothing but \u2018lazy writing\u2019. It is a different style for me to read, yes. But, I am very open to new styles especially when it comes to books. This one just didn\u2019t do it for me. The story is butchered into a million parts. It is really difficult to understand the link of one thing to other: whether it\u2019s her childhood continuation or her adulthood continuation &amp; how it all holds up together.<o:p><\/o:p><\/span><\/div>\n<div><\/div>\n<div><span style=\"font-family: &quot;sitka banner&quot;; font-size: 13.0pt; line-height: 107%;\">After reading books like \u2018<a href=\"https:\/\/mindscapeinwords.com\/2019\/07\/the-hate-u-give-mindscape-reviews.html\">The Hate U Give<\/a>\u2019 which focusses on racism toward African-Americans, it is impossible to read anything on a related matter &amp; actually like it. The standards set in that book are high &amp; it has become the level against which I will review similar \/ related books of that nature. In \u2018The Atlas of Reds and Blues\u2019, I didn\u2019t find a single thing that will make people weep because of the cruelty of racism like it does in \u2018The Hate U Give\u2019. The Atlas of Reds and Blues is not written well enough, in all terms: novel style or prose style or metaphorical style or social matters style. <o:p><\/o:p><\/span><\/div>\n<div><span style=\"font-family: &quot;sitka banner&quot;; font-size: 13.0pt; line-height: 107%;\">I cannot stress how difficult it was to read the book.
